London: Methuen, 1904. hardcover. very good(+). 16 color plates by Thomas Rowlandson. 12mo, red cloth with paper label on spine. London: Methuen, 1904. Vry good (+).<br/><br/> Not to be confused with another work by Mitford, originally published in 1819 with exactly the same title, and illustrated with 20 plates by Charles Williams.<br/><br/>
